What Is a "Research Peptide"?
A research peptide is a synthetic peptide compound sold with the legal disclaimer that it is intended for laboratory research, in vitro studies, or educational purposes only — not for human consumption. In practice, the vast majority of research peptides sold online were purchased by individuals for self-administration.

The "Research" Label Problem
The research peptide designation created several critical issues:
1. No manufacturing oversight: Research peptides are not manufactured under Good Manufacturing Practice (GMP) conditions. There is no regulatory body inspecting facilities, testing batches, or enforcing quality standards.
2. No purity guarantees: When you buy research peptides, the purity listed on the label (typically "≥98%") is self-reported by the manufacturer. Independent testing frequently reveals actual purity levels of 85-95%, with the remainder consisting of synthesis byproducts, truncated peptide sequences, and chemical contaminants.
3. No sterility assurance: Injectable research peptides are often lyophilized (freeze-dried) in non-sterile environments. Particulate matter, bacterial endotoxins, and microbial contamination have been documented in independent testing of research chemical peptide products.
4. No dosing accuracy: Vial-to-vial variation in research peptides can be significant. A vial labeled "5mg BPC-157" might contain 3.8mg or 6.2mg — making consistent dosing impossible.
5. No adverse event reporting: Because research peptides are sold "not for human consumption," there is no pharmacovigilance system. Adverse events go unreported, and safety signals are invisible.
What Are Clinical-Grade Peptides?
Clinical-grade peptides (also called pharmaceutical-grade peptides) are manufactured under regulated conditions with quality controls that ensure safety, purity, potency, and sterility for human use.
Pharmaceutical-Grade Manufacturing Standards
- GMP Compliance: Clinical-grade peptides are produced in facilities that comply with Good Manufacturing Practice regulations. This means:
- Documented standard operating procedures for every production step
- Environmental monitoring of manufacturing areas (particle counts, microbial limits)
- Validated sterilization processes (autoclave, filtration, or aseptic fill)
- Equipment calibration and maintenance records
- Personnel training and hygiene protocols
- Quality Control Testing: Every batch of clinical-grade peptide undergoes:
- HPLC purity analysis: High-performance liquid chromatography confirms peptide identity and purity (typically ≥99%)
- Mass spectrometry: Confirms correct molecular weight and amino acid sequence
- Endotoxin testing: LAL (Limulus amebocyte lysate) test ensures injectable products are free of bacterial endotoxins
- Sterility testing: Culture-based sterility assays confirm no microbial contamination
- Particulate matter testing: Visual and instrumental inspection for visible and sub-visible particles
- Potency assay: Confirms the stated dose is accurate within ±5%
- Batch Documentation: Every vial of a pharmaceutical-grade peptide can be traced to:
- Raw material certificates of analysis
- Manufacturing batch records
- Quality control test results
- Stability data supporting the stated expiration date
- Certificate of analysis (COA) available to the end user

Why Platform Bans on Research Peptides Are Accelerating
The ban on research peptides across platforms like Alibaba reflects several converging pressures:
Regulatory Enforcement
The FDA has taken increasingly aggressive action against research peptide sellers and compounding pharmacies using Category 2 substances. Warning letters, seizures, and injunctions have increased substantially since 2024.Liability Exposure
Platforms like Alibaba recognized that hosting research peptide listings created legal exposure. When products labeled "not for human use" are clearly being used by humans — and adverse events occur — platform liability becomes a serious concern.Consumer Protection
Multiple reports of contaminated, underdosed, or mislabeled research chemical peptides have received media attention. Platform bans reduce reputational risk.Keyword Restrictions
Alibaba's ban extends beyond specific substances to keyword combinations. Terms like "research" + "peptide," "bioactive" + "peptide," "anti aging" + "peptide," "weight loss" + "peptide," "injection" + "peptide," "bodybuilding" + "peptide," and "muscle building" + "peptide" are all restricted. When evaluating whether a peptide product is truly pharmaceutical grade vs. relabeled research grade, look for these markers:
1. Manufacturer Identification
Clinical-grade: Named, verifiable manufacturer with a physical address, GMP certification, and regulatory registrations (e.g., BioPhausia/Sweden for Tationil, Glutax from Philippines FDA-registered facilities)Research-grade: Manufacturer unnamed, listed as a generic "peptide synthesis lab," or located at addresses that don't correspond to manufacturing facilities
2. Packaging and Labeling
Clinical-grade: Professional pharmaceutical packaging with lot numbers, expiration dates, storage conditions, full ingredient lists, and dosage information. No "for research only" disclaimers.Research-grade: Generic vials with simple printed labels, "for research purposes only" disclaimer, minimal or no lot tracking, and often no expiration date
3. Certificate of Analysis
Clinical-grade: Batch-specific COA with HPLC chromatograms, mass spec data, endotoxin results, sterility results, and potency assay — available on request or included with purchaseResearch-grade: Generic COA (often the same document used for years), limited to a single HPLC purity number, no endotoxin or sterility data
4. Regulatory Registration
Clinical-grade: Product is registered with at least one national pharmaceutical regulatory authority (FDA, EMA, TGA, Philippines FDA, etc.)Research-grade: No regulatory registration of any kind
